  • Each of the four huts that i visited, are loaded with history from the days of mountain cattlemen.
    The Victorian High Country huts were built by the families of the mountain cattlemen, dating well back into the mid to late 1900's.
    They built the huts to use as shelter when they would spend weeks on end mustering cattle on the higher mountain peaks during the summer months with their cattle.
    Today, the mountain cattlemen don't use the huts that they once built for mustering purposes, because the cattle aren't allowed to graze the large parts of the Victorian High Country.
    So, they still stand for campers to visit when they are passing through the region in the 4WD.
    I't very important to look after these very historical cattle huts, so they remain for everyone to enjoy them and take a moment to think about the days of the mountain cattlemen.
    Victorian High Country huts are scattered through out the region.
    We visit the iconic Craigs Hut and three other mountain cattlemen huts.
    Craig's Hut wasn't used or built by the mountain cattlemen, it was built as a film prop for the iconic Australia movie series, The Man From Snowy River.
    Each and every one of them is is filled with character and history from days gone by.
    The four Victorian High Country huts I have selected out from Mansfield, are quite easy to get to in your 4wd.
